region Southwest Colorado Economic Development
Region 9 Economic Development District of Southwest Colorado, Inc. (Region 9 EDD) is a Colorado non-profit community economic development corporation that promotes and coordinates economic development throughout Southwest Colorado. It serves Archuleta, Dolores, La Plata, Montezuma and San Juan counties, the cities and towns within those regions, and the Southern Ute Indian Tribe and the Ute Mountain Ute Tribe.
